This is the last lunar eclipse of 2022; according to astrology, it will happen in Aries. The lunar eclipse mentioned is a total lunar eclipse.

This lunar eclipse will be visible mainly from north-eastern Europe and most of Asia, Australia, the Pacific Ocean, the Indian Ocean, North America, and South America.  It cannot be seen from southwestern Europe and the African continent.  The total lunar eclipse in India will be visible only from the eastern regions.  The year-end lunar eclipse will be visible from Kolkata, Siliguri, Patna, Ranchi, and Guwahati.
